Caterpillar 5-Ton vs Huber 20-40 Super Four
Side-by-side specs comparison
Verdict by the numbers
- The Caterpillar 5-Ton and the Huber 20-40 Super Four deliver the same power: 44 HP.
- The Huber 20-40 Super Four is the more recent model: production started in 1926, versus 1925 for the Caterpillar 5-Ton.
Full specs comparison
| Caterpillar 5-Ton | Huber 20-40 Super Four | |
|---|---|---|
| Power | 44 HP | 44 HP |
| Production years | 1925–1926 | 1926–1928 |
| Fuel | Gasoline | Gasoline |
| Cylinders | 4 | 4 |
| Displacement | 7 L | 8.8 L |
| Weight | — | 4 166 kg |
| Drive | — | 2WD |
| Transmission | Gear | Gear |
| Gears (fwd/rev) | 3 / 1 | 2 / 1 |
| Wheelbase | — | 241 cm |
| Length | — | 406 cm |
